#7e7476 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7e7476 is composed of 49.4% red, 45.5%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.9% magenta, 6.3%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 348 degrees, a saturation of 4.1% and a lightness of 47.5%. #7e7476 color hex could be obtained by blending #fce8ec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#7e7476

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030303 is the darkest color, while #f9f8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7e7476

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7476 is the less saturated color, while #ee0433 is the most saturated one.
